UAE bars under-15s from social media

The UAE has banned social media for children under 15, following Australia, Britain and Canada in a growing global push to shield kids from online harm.

The UAE just drew a hard line in the sand: no more social media for anyone under 15. Per a cabinet resolution reported by state news agency WAM, platforms now have 12 months to identify and disable underage accounts — or face being blocked entirely, reports Punch.

Kids aged 15-16 get limited access with “enhanced protective measures,” but full features like commenting, sharing and group chats stay off-limits. Parents can’t opt their kids out of the rules either — consent doesn’t count as an exemption.

It’s the first such ban in the Arab world, joining Australia, the UK and others.
